Now coming to the list of databases that you see, notice the date in each of the database files, except the first. Every night when a new backup is generated, it is saved as msgstore.db.crypt12. msgstore.db.crypt12 is the file with the latest WhatsApp chat backup. This is the file used for automatic chat and contact recovery after reinstallation of WhatsApp. msgstore-2016-11-08.1.db.crypt12 is a backup copy of the application's chats for a certain date which is given in the file name.

How to open a CRYPT12 file. You can use a CRYPT12 file to migrate or restore your WhatsApp message history on an Android device. To do so, you must rename your most recent CRYPT12 file to msgstore.db.crypt12 before reinstalling WhatsApp and, when prompted, manually restoring your message history. You can delete DB.CRYPT12 files to reclaim storage space but you will delete messages stored in the DB.CRYPT12 database.
